Shiffrin’s Triumph: Clinches Slalom Title Ahead of Saalbach Final

On March 10th Ă…re, Sweden hosted the final regular season slalom of the 2024 season. It would witness the injury return of Stifel US Ski Team's Mikaela Shiffrin. Even if Germany's Lena DĂĽrr could find a way to win, Shiffrin would only need 13 points to clinch the season's slalom title. However, In her first race back since January 26th, Shiffrin did much more. The first run leader ended the day with her career 96th victory, her 59th in slalom. On the hill, she won her first World Cup and clinched the 2024 slalom title, her eighth.

Manuel Feller becomes World Cup slalom king in unlikely fashion

The veteran Austrian racer officially clinched his first season title when the Kranjska Gora slalom was wiped out three days before the scheduled race. Heavy rainfall devoured the Slovenian race course, leaving race organizers with no choice but to cancel.

EISA’s Class of 2024 Reflects on a Unique Journey

Last weekend at the Middlebury Regional Championships and this week at the NCAA National Championships in Steamboat, the EISA’s Class of 2024 wraps up the final college racing turns of their undergraduate careers. Thanks to the 2020 COVID pandemic, most of them had no college racing as First Years, when Ivy League and NESCAC schools canceled their 202/21 competition seasons. Instead, they scrambled to train and race through pandemic restrictions and strict quarantine requirements that forced athletes to pick a state and stay there.
